30 Healthy Meal Prep Ideas

Updated on Oct. 13, 2023

From big batches of tuna salad to a pot of vegetable stew, planning meals in advance is one of the easiest ways to eat healthy and save money. Here are our favorite healthy meal prep ideas to make on Sunday and enjoy all week long.

Quinoa Patties

Total Time 30 min
Servings 4 servings
From the Recipe Creator: This easy to make veggie burger packs an amazing taste, and the crunch from the addition of quinoa makes the texture to die for. This is an easy and delicious vegetarian burger option that you must try. Pan-frying adds a perfect crisp that takes it to the next level. The mixture can be made ahead of time, and it freezes very well. Enjoy! —Beth Klein, Arlington, Virginia
Nutrition Facts: 2 patties: 235 calories, 10g fat (1g saturated fat), 47mg cholesterol, 273mg sodium, 28g carbohydrate (2g sugars, 5g fiber), 8g protein. Diabetic Exchanges: 2 starch, 1-1/2 fat, 1 lean meat.

From the Recipe Creator: In the past few years, I’ve been trying to incorporate more whole grains in our dinners. Bulgur is one of my favorite grains to work with because of its quick cooking time. Besides being high in fiber and rich in minerals, it has a mild, nutty flavor that my kids enjoy. —Maria Vasseur, Valencia, California
Nutrition Facts: 1-1/4 cups with 2 tablespoons topping: 387 calories, 6g fat (1g saturated fat), 45mg cholesterol, 628mg sodium, 59g carbohydrate (7g sugars, 14g fiber), 27g protein.
